How Does Caffeine Affect Fibromyalgia?

Fibromyalgia is a chronic condition causing widespread pain, persistent fatigue, and sleep disturbances. It also often involves cognitive difficulties, sometimes referred to as “fibro fog.” Many individuals with fibromyalgia consider caffeine, a widely consumed stimulant, for symptom management. This article explores the relationship between caffeine consumption and fibromyalgia symptoms.

Understanding Fibromyalgia and Caffeine

Fibromyalgia is characterized by chronic widespread pain that can affect various parts of the body, including the neck, shoulders, back, and hips. Researchers believe fibromyalgia affects how the brain and spinal cord process pain signals, leading to heightened sensitivity.

Caffeine is a central nervous system stimulant found in coffee, tea, chocolate, and various energy drinks. It is rapidly absorbed into the bloodstream and can cross the blood-brain barrier.

Caffeine’s General Effects on the Body

Caffeine primarily exerts its effects by blocking adenosine, a naturally occurring brain chemical that promotes relaxation and drowsiness. By binding to adenosine receptors, caffeine prevents adenosine from slowing down nerve cell activity, leading to increased alertness and a temporary reduction in feelings of fatigue. This action can also indirectly influence the release of other neurotransmitters like dopamine and norepinephrine.

While caffeine can improve reaction time and concentration, its effects are temporary, typically lasting three to four hours for a moderate dose. Consuming caffeine, especially in larger amounts, can lead to side effects such as anxiety, nervousness, and restlessness. It can also disrupt sleep cycles, particularly if consumed too close to bedtime.

Caffeine’s Impact on Fibromyalgia Symptoms

The relationship between caffeine and fibromyalgia symptoms is nuanced and highly individual. Some individuals with fibromyalgia report temporary benefits from caffeine, while others find it exacerbates their symptoms.

Some people with fibromyalgia might experience temporary relief from fatigue or improved alertness after consuming caffeine. This stimulating effect can counteract the profound tiredness often associated with the condition. Research suggests that caffeine might aid physical function and reduce pain catastrophizing in some fibromyalgia patients.

Despite potential temporary benefits, caffeine can also worsen common fibromyalgia symptoms. Sleep disruption is a significant concern, as caffeine can delay sleep onset and reduce sleep quality, which is already a prevalent issue for those with fibromyalgia. The stimulant effects of caffeine can increase nervous system activity, potentially heightening pain perception, muscle tension, or anxiety.

A “caffeine crash” can occur as the effects wear off, leading to increased fatigue, headaches, and irritability. This rebound effect can intensify existing fibromyalgia symptoms. Studies have also indicated a complex relationship between caffeine and pain severity; while low to moderate intake showed little association with pain, very high daily caffeine consumption was linked to greater pain levels in some fibromyalgia patients.

Navigating Caffeine Use with Fibromyalgia

Managing caffeine intake with fibromyalgia often requires an individualized approach, as responses vary significantly. Observing and tracking personal symptoms in relation to caffeine consumption can provide valuable insights, helping identify specific patterns or triggers.

Gradual adjustments to caffeine intake are generally recommended rather than abrupt changes. Suddenly stopping caffeine can lead to withdrawal symptoms like headaches, fatigue, and irritability, which could worsen existing fibromyalgia symptoms. Reducing intake slowly can help the body adapt and minimize unpleasant side effects.

Limiting caffeine consumption, particularly in the afternoon and evening, can help prevent sleep disruption. Since caffeine’s effects can last for several hours, early morning consumption allows most of the stimulant to clear the system before bedtime.

Exploring non-caffeinated alternatives for energy or focus, such as regular exercise or mindfulness practices, can also be beneficial. Before making significant dietary changes, consulting with a healthcare provider is important.
